Short Term Breaks

The school offers Short Break provision for young people currently enrolled at the school, either day or residential, who may have difficulty accessing alternative provision.

The policies and procedures currently in place are applicable during the Short Break provision. There will be an emphasis on social and leisure activities whilst continuing the Care Policy ethos of maximising social and emotional skills, self-confidence/image and self-care skills.

The young people stay in ‘The Woodlands’, a complex of 3 modern, spacious, purpose built, well equipped 8 bedded units situated in the grounds of the school.

The provision is managed by a designated manager and the young people will be cared for by existing staff members from the school who will have a good knowledge of the young persons needs and behaviours.

A member of the schools senior management team is also on call 24 hours a day. 

There is a full package of activities for the young people to participate in with a wide variety of activities that are relaxing, stimulating and offers the chance for physical exercise. All of the schools facilities are available for use during their time here including the use of the fleet of vehicles.

At the end of the stay you will receive a bound diary on how they have been and what they have participated in each day including lots of photographs.

All bookings must be made through your social worker who will be responsible for all fees.
